About the Role:
As an English/Drama Teacher, you will be responsible for teaching English Language, English Literature, and Drama to students across Key Stage 3 and 4. The ideal candidate will have a strong academic background, a passion for literature and drama, and a commitment to fostering a love of learning in our students. You will play a key role in ensuring high standards of teaching and learning, promoting a positive and respectful classroom culture, and helping students achieve their full potential.

Responsibilities:
Plan and deliver engaging lessons in English Language, English Literature, and Drama.

Assess and monitor student progress and provide constructive feedback to support development.

Maintain a positive, supportive, and inclusive classroom environment.

Encourage students to participate in extracurricular activities, including drama productions and English-related events.

Collaborate with colleagues to enhance the overall curriculum and support whole-school initiatives.

Contribute to the wider school community through mentoring, pastoral care, and involvement in school events.

The Ideal Candidate:
A qualified teacher with a strong background in English and Drama.

Passionate about inspiring students and cultivating a love of literature and performance.

Proven ability to differentiate teaching to meet the needs of a diverse range of learners.

Strong classroom management skills and a commitment to high standards of teaching and learning.

A team player who is proactive, adaptable, and collaborative.

Experience in delivering GCSE English and Drama is desirable, but not essential.
